Daan Oilfield in Fuyu Reservoir of Ultra Low Permeability Sandstone Reservoir Seepage Parameter Technology
Meiling Jiang,Yunfeng Zhang
Published : March 21, 2016
DOI : N/A
Abstract
Abstract: Oil-water relative permeability curve is used to describe two-phase fluid in reservoir porous media of non-linear percolation in the only way. Low permeability reservoir of oil and water relative permeability curves with high permeability reservoir of oil-water relative permeability curves of different features. Specific performance: the high bound water saturation, residual oil saturation is high, narrow range of oil-water two-phase flow, with the decrease of the saturation of oil phase, oil phase permeability decreases rapidly, and soon fell to zero, to form a high residual oil saturation and water flooding oil recovery rate is very low, and the aqueous phase effective permeability increases very slowly, resulting in low permeability reservoir well with increase of water content, the produced fluid index drop Low liquid production is very low. Fuyu oil layer in the study area mainly belong to low porosity and ultra low porosity and super low permeability non permeable reservoir, through the research found the oil-water two-phase flow characteristics is more complex, with middle high permeability reservoir and low permeability reservoir layer had greater differences.
